Jay Robb Whey Protein Powder Yogurt review
This is a brief video review (3 minutes) on Jay Robb Whey Protein Powder being mixed with yogurt.
Just like when you’re mixing with a liquid, make sure your yogurt is very cold. I actually put mine back in the freezer for five minutes after stirring it to make it a little colder.
Once mixed thoroughly, I found the protein powder/yogurt mix very smooth and creamy, almost like some frostings. Definitely thicker than regular yogurt and almost the texture and thickness of some puddings. The cocoa-y taste was not overpowering.
This first ingredient in this shake is cold-processed cross-flow microfiltered whey protein isolate. One serving has 25 grams of protein and 110 calories. The available flavors are Vanilla, Chocolate, Strawberry, Pina Colada and Tropical Dreamsicle. An unflavored variety is also available. Jay Robb Whey Protein Powder is available in single serving packets as well as 12 ounce, 24 ounce and 80 ounce containers.
